Sentenced VR is one of the most interesting and unique ideas for a VR game I think I have ever come across. As the title suggests, this is a VR game so you will need a VR headset in order to play it. I have an Oculus Quest 2 and it worked fine with that and to be honest I have not heard anyone say that they had trouble getting this to run on their VR hardware. The game is only around an hour long, but the fact that this was made by just one dude is very impressive.

Off With Their Head!

The idea of Sentenced VR is that we take the role of executioner for this medieval European town. Our father had this post before us and now it is us who have to act out the justice that those who run this place seem fit. This is such a cool idea for a story and what I liked about it was that it did throw some moral shade your way. You may think that you will just chop, chop, and chop some more as these are all criminals at the end of the day, but things are not always what they seem.

Who Are You To Judge?

The clever aspect of Sentenced VR is how you get a bit of story before each execution and then we get to hear from the criminal as they plead their case, spit in the face of authority, or so on. It makes for a rather interesting dynamic where you know what your job is, but you may not agree with the person being beheaded for their crime or you may even think that they are innocent of what they are being charged with.

Swing And A Miss

As Sentenced VR is a VR game, we actually have to swing our sword to act out the justice that has been demanded. This works really well and was quite fun, but it is pretty much the only gameplay that you have here and you will be doing the same thing over and over again. Speaking of which, I wanted to refuse to behead a person and see what would happen, but it just made me replay the game from the start again! I am not sure if this was a glitch, but it made me hesitant to stand up to those above me, I guess that was the point. It only takes about an hour to beat, but I am okay with that as the game ends before you tire of it. Picking up money, sharpening your blade, and so on do add a bit of variety to the gameplay.

Nothing Dishonorable Here

That is actually a bit of a pun as the old timey medieval European town that Sentenced VR is set in reminds me of Dunwall from the Dishonored games. The game is not the easiest on the eyes, but for the most part, it gets the job done, the way the characters can look at you in the eye makes some of the beheadings that you have to do quite brutal actually. There is voice acting here and for such a small project, I was very impressed with the quality of the voice acting.

While there is not a great deal to Sentenced VR, I think that this is a very interesting VR experience and I am glad that I played it. I would like to try and play through it again to see if my game did just glitch on me when I defined authority! If you do have a VR headset and you want to try a game that is a bit more unique, I highly recommend that you check this one out.

Pros:

  • A VR game where you play as an executioner is a great idea
  • I liked the setting of the game
  • The bits of story and lore that we pick up are interesting
  • I liked swinging the sword!

Cons:

  • There is not much to the gameplay as you do the same thing over and over again
  • I am not sure if the game glitched, but a choice I made meant I had to replay the 30 minutes I already had!
